Deciphering the Dream: Key Factors to Consider
Several factors significantly contribute to understanding the meaning of a dream about a nail falling off. Let's examine these crucial elements:
1. The Condition of the Nail:
-
Healthy Nail: A healthy nail falling off suggests a sudden and unexpected loss or disruption. This might involve a relationship, a job, or a sense of stability. The suddenness emphasizes the feeling of being unprepared or overwhelmed.
-
Diseased or Damaged Nail: A diseased or damaged nail falling off signifies a gradual weakening or deterioration. This could reflect underlying health issues, strained relationships, or a project that's slowly crumbling. The dream highlights the need for attention and potential intervention.
-
Bloody Nail: The presence of blood adds another layer of significance. Blood in dreams often symbolizes strong emotions, passion, or vital energy. A bloody nail falling off suggests a painful loss, potentially a deep emotional wound that needs healing.
2. Location of the Nail:
-
Fingernail: Fingernails represent our ability to grasp, create, and connect with the world. A falling fingernail can signify a loss of control, a diminished ability to manifest our goals, or a weakening in our personal relationships.
-
Toenail: Toenails represent our grounding and stability. A falling toenail might indicate feelings of insecurity, a loss of direction, or a lack of support. It suggests a need to reconnect with your foundation and find your footing.
-
Other Body Parts: While less common, a nail falling off from other parts of the body should be considered within the specific context of the dream. To give you an idea, a nail falling from a hand might suggest a loss of creative ability, while one falling from a foot might point to a disruption in your journey.
3. The Emotional Response in the Dream:
Your emotional state during the dream is just as crucial as the visual elements.
-
Fear or Anxiety: Experiencing fear or anxiety alongside the falling nail intensifies the sense of loss or vulnerability. This suggests a deep-seated fear of change or insecurity.
-
Indifference: Feeling indifferent towards the falling nail might indicate a subconscious acceptance of change or loss. This doesn't necessarily mean it's easy, but it could signify a sense of resilience and preparedness.
-
Relief: Surprisingly, some individuals report feeling relief when a nail falls off in their dream. This could symbolize the shedding of a burden, the release of negative energy, or the letting go of something that was no longer serving them.
4. The Surrounding Context:
The events surrounding the falling nail provide valuable clues to its interpretation. Consider:
-
Setting: Where did the nail fall off? Was it a familiar location or somewhere unfamiliar? The setting can offer symbolic clues about the area of life affected.
-
People Involved: Were there other people present? How did they react? The interactions with others can illuminate the impact of the loss on your relationships.
-
Actions Taken: Did you attempt to reattach the nail? Did you seek help? Your actions in the dream reflect your coping mechanisms and approach to challenges in waking life.

Psychological Interpretations: Uncovering Hidden Fears and Insecurities
From a psychological perspective, a nail falling off in a dream can represent various anxieties and insecurities:
-
Loss of Control: The dream might signify a feeling of losing control over a situation or aspect of your life. This loss of control could stem from various sources – work pressures, relationship problems, or even health concerns.
-
Vulnerability: The image of a detached nail directly correlates with a feeling of vulnerability and exposure. The dream could highlight your sensitivity to criticism or your fear of being judged.
-
Weakening Self-Esteem: If the nail was damaged before it fell, the dream may be a reflection of low self-esteem or a lack of confidence in your abilities.
-
Inability to Cope: The dream could point to feelings of inadequacy or an inability to cope with stress or challenges. The falling nail may represent the breaking point, where you feel overwhelmed and unable to hold things together.
-
Fear of Abandonment: Depending on the context, the dream might represent a fear of abandonment, whether it's from a romantic partner, a friend, or even a sense of self-abandonment.
Spiritual Interpretations: Shedding the Old, Embracing the New
From a spiritual perspective, the falling nail can symbolize:
-
Letting Go: The nail falling off might represent the need to release something that no longer serves you. This could be a negative habit, a toxic relationship, or an outdated belief system.
-
Transformation: Just as a nail can be replaced, the dream might indicate a period of transformation and renewal. It suggests a process of shedding the old to make way for the new.
-
Growth: While painful, the loss represented by the falling nail could pave the way for significant personal growth and self-discovery.
-
Release of Negative Energy: The dream could be a symbolic representation of releasing pent-up negative energy or emotions. The falling nail might be a cathartic release of stress and tension.
-
Spiritual Awakening: In some contexts, the dream could even symbolize a spiritual awakening or a shift in consciousness. The falling nail might signify the breaking down of old limitations and the emergence of a new perspective.
Common Questions and Answers (FAQ)
-
Q: What if I dream about multiple nails falling off? A: Dreaming about multiple nails falling off amplifies the themes discussed earlier. It suggests a greater sense of vulnerability, a more significant loss of control, or a more profound need for change. The number of nails could even symbolize the number of areas in your life needing attention.
-
Q: What if the nail grows back in my dream? A: The regrowth of the nail signifies resilience, healing, and the capacity for renewal. It's a positive sign, suggesting that you possess the strength to overcome challenges and rebuild.
-
Q: What if I try to reattach the nail in the dream? A: Trying to reattach the nail suggests a desire to cling to the past, avoid change, or regain control. While understandable, this may indicate a need to accept the inevitable changes happening in your life.
